To uncover the most Instagrammable across the globe, long-haul travel experts Travelbag compared 45 of the world's most popular long-haul islands, analysing Instagram hashtag data to reveal which are stealing the spotlight in 2025.
Famed for its stunning landscapes, warm hospitality, and rich cultural heritage, Bali is also the most visited island in .
Sri Lanka, often called the 'Pearl of the Indian Ocean' ranks as the world's second most Instagrammable island, with over 18 million hashtags.
Among its many highlights is Adam's Peak, a sacred mountain where pilgrims ascend by candlelight to view a revered footprint believed to be that of Buddha.
Claiming the third spot is Cuba, with over 15.3 million hashtags on Instagram. Located in the , the island is renowned for its vibrant music, dance, and cuisine.
It's also a favourite among beach lovers, home to some of the world's most stunning sandy shores, like Playa Varadero, famous for its turquoise waters and powdery white sand.
Jamaica ranks fourth among the most Instagrammable , with over 15.3 million hashtags on Instagram.
Known for its vibrant reggae music, , and spectacular waterfalls, the island is the perfect destination for travellers seeking a mix of cultural richness, natural beauty and laid-back .
Completing the top five is Phuket, with over 12.7 million hashtags on Instagram. Located in southern Thailand, the island is known for its and vibrant nightlife.
